Card Counting
Blackjack, the captivating casino game of skill and chance, offers an intriguing opportunity for players to tilt the odds in their favor. While luck absolutely plays a role, savvy players can harness a powerful technique known as card counting to gain a significant advantage over the house. Card counting involves meticulously tracking the ratio of high and low cards remaining in the deck, allowing astute players to adjust their betting strategies accordingly.
By spotting patterns in the dealt cards, skilled card counters can determine the probability of favorable outcomes. When the deck becomes abundant in high cards, a counter may boost their bets, as the chances of winning improve. Conversely, when the deck tilts low cards, they decrease their wagers to minimize potential losses.
While card counting may seem like a complex endeavor, its fundamental principles are fairly straightforward. With dedicated practice and commitment, even novice players can acquire the skills necessary to proficiently implement this valuable strategy.

The Art and Science of Card Counting
Card counting is a fascinating skill that blends calculation with sharp observation. It's a system used primarily in blackjack to gain an edge over the casino by tracking the ratio of high to low cards remaining in the deck. While it may seem like merely luck, card counting is a mathematical process that requires focus.
A skilled counter can adjust their betting strategy based on the ongoing count, increasing bets when the odds are in their favor and lowering them when the advantage shifts. Mastering this skill takes dedication, as it involves recalling complex patterns and adapting to ever-changing situations.
Despite its popularity in popular culture, card counting is a polarizing topic. Casinos often utilize measures to detect counters and may even ban them from playing. However, for those willing to put in the effort, card counting can be a gratifying challenge that blurs the lines between probability and skill.
